About Frédéric Fortis

Frédéric Fortis is a scholar working on Spectroscopy, Molecular Biology, Radiology, Nuclear Medicine and Imaging, Organic Chemistry and Oncology, having authored 19 papers that have together received 826 indexed citations. Recurring topics across this work include Advanced Proteomics Techniques and Applications (13 papers), Monoclonal and Polyclonal Antibodies Research (7 papers), Mass Spectrometry Techniques and Applications (7 papers), Protein purification and stability (6 papers), Analytical Chemistry and Chromatography (4 papers), Chemical Synthesis and Analysis (3 papers), Glycosylation and Glycoproteins Research (2 papers) and Molecular spectroscopy and chirality (2 papers). The work is most often cited by research in Spectroscopy (505 citations), Radiology, Nuclear Medicine and Imaging (174 citations), Molecular Biology (517 citations), Microbiology (24 citations) and Immunology and Allergy (18 citations). Frédéric Fortis has collaborated with scholars based in Italy, France and United States. Frequent co-authors include Egisto Boschetti, Pier Giorgio Righetti, Luc Guerrier, Annalisa Castagna, Lee Lomas, Juri Rappsilber, Paolo Antonioli, Angela Bachi, Lau Sennels and Daniela Cecconi. Their work appears in journals such as PROTEOMICS, Journal of Proteome Research, Journal of Proteomics, Analytical Chemistry and Journal of Chromatography A.
